WebThe earliest Persian names were shah, farzin, pil, asp, rukh, and piyada. In Arabic they were shah, firzan, fil, faras, rukhkh, and baidaq. Countries of the western world translated the earliest names as closely as possible. ... WebNames of chess pieces are King, Queen, Rook, Bishop, Knight and Pawn. There is a total of 32 pieces on the board, 16 pieces each for both white and black. The Rook, Bishop and Knight come in pairs and there are 8 pawns on the board for each side. There is only one King and one Queen for each side, with white to play first.
